Pamela Wallack
2017
In 2017, Pamela Wallack earned a total compensation of $4.9M as Former President, Global Product at Childrens Place.
Compensation breakdown
Non-Equity Incentive Plan | $800,000 |
---|---|
Salary | $553,846 |
Stock Awards | $3,500,381 |
Other | $358 |
Total | $4,854,585 |
Wallack received $3.5M in stock awards, accounting for 72% of the total pay in 2017.
Wallack also received $800K in non-equity incentive plan, $553.8K in salary and $358 in other compensation.
